I downloaded Gabriel Knight 3 and the first time it booted up without any problems. Then I changed the the 3D driver from the advanced options to my Radeon HD 6870, but that made some of the mouse icons disappear, so I changed it back to the default option. As soon as I did that en error prompt appears saying "Unrecognized fatal exception", and when I press OK the game crashes. I tried to start the game again and it showed the sierra intro, the main menu and the starting screen (the one that tells the time and the picture of the conductor), but as soon as the gameplay starts, the error prompt appears.

After that I searched online for help and downloaded the batch file from the sierra help desk that changes the name of some file so that the game could recognize it, but it didn't work. The site also said that the error prompt could appear if the files on the hard drive had trouble reading some of the files in the CD-ROM, of course this could not be the problem. Then I tried to completely delete any sign that the game was ever on my computer and downloaded it again, but still the error prompt was there.

Now I have no idea what's causing it and no idea how to fix it, so if someone could help me I would be incredibly grateful.

Wit further investigation I realized taht I didn't change the 3D driver the the default one, but to "software renderer". Since you can only change setting while in gameplay, I can't change the driver back to the default one.

So now I need to know how I can change the game settings outside of the game.

Well I found the solution:

I launched the registry editor and from there I opened the Sierra On-Line file and deleted the Gabriel Knight 3 file (from there you could've changed some of the setting, but I found it easier to just delete the damn thing), reinstalled the game and the problem was solved.
